Statamic CMS Development
This skill covers how to work with the Statamic CMS layer: content structure, blueprints, fieldsets, and writing content files.
Content File Format
All content lives in content/ as Markdown files with YAML front matter. The front matter holds all field data; the body after --- is typically empty (Bard fields are stored in the front matter, not the Markdown body).
---
id: unique-id
blueprint: page
title: My Page
some_field: value
---Every entry must have an id (unique across the site) and a blueprint that determines which fields are available.
Collections
Collections live in content/collections/. Each collection has a config YAML at content/collections/{handle}.yaml and entries as .md files in content/collections/{handle}/.
Collection Config
# content/collections/{handle}.yaml
title: Articles
template: articles/show # Default Antlers template
layout: layout # Layout wrapper
route: '/articles/{slug}' # URL pattern
sort_dir: desc
revisions: true
structure: # Only for structured collections
root: true # true = can have entries at root level
taxonomies:
- categories # Attach taxonomy terms
preview_targets:
-
label: Entry
url: '{permalink}'
refresh: trueThe pages collection is a default Statamic structured collection using {parent_uri}/{slug} routing and a tree structure.
Blueprints
Blueprints define the field schema for entries. They live in resources/blueprints/collections/{collection}/{blueprint}.yaml.
Blueprint Structure
title: Page
tabs:
main:
display: Main
sections:
-
display: Content
fields:
-
handle: title
field:
type: text
required: true
validate:
- required
-
import: my_fieldset # Import a fieldset
seo:
display: SEO
sections:
-
fields:
-
import: common/seo # Import from subfolder
sidebar:
display: Sidebar
sections:
-
fields:
-
handle: slug
field:
type: slug
localizable: true
validate: 'max:200'Tabs organise the CP editing UI. The sidebar tab renders in the right sidebar. Use import: to pull in reusable fieldsets.
Fieldsets
Reusable field groups live in resources/fieldsets/. They are imported into blueprints and other fieldsets with import: {path}.
Fieldsets in subfolders are referenced with dot or slash notation (e.g. import: common/seo or import: common.seo).

Bard fields store content as a ProseMirror document structure in YAML. This is an array of nodes, not raw HTML or Markdown. Understanding this structure is essential when writing or editing content files by hand.
Basic Structure
A Bard field value is an array of block-level nodes. Each node has a type and usually content (an array of inline nodes):
my_bard_field:
-
type: paragraph
content:
-
type: text
text: 'Plain paragraph text.'Paragraphs
The most common node. Contains inline text nodes:
-
type: paragraph
content:
-
type: text
text: 'This is a paragraph.'A paragraph with text alignment uses attrs:
-
type: paragraph
attrs:
textAlign: center
content:
-
type: text
text: 'Centered paragraph text.'Headings
Headings use the heading type with a level attribute:
-
type: heading
attrs:
level: 2
content:
-
type: text
text: 'This is an H2'Valid levels: 1 through 6 (corresponding to h1–h6). Only use levels that are enabled in the Bard field's buttons config.
Inline Formatting (Marks)
Bold, italic, and other inline styles are applied via marks on text nodes. Multiple marks can be combined on a single text node:
Bold:
-
type: text
marks:
-
type: bold
text: 'Bold text'Italic:
-
type: text
marks:
-
type: italic
text: 'Italic text'Bold + Italic:
-
type: text
marks:
-
type: bold
-
type: italic
text: 'Bold and italic'Underline:
-
type: text
marks:
-
type: underline
text: 'Underlined text'Strikethrough:
-
type: text
marks:
-
type: strike
text: 'Struck through'Inline code:
-
type: text
marks:
-
type: code
text: 'some_code()'Superscript / Subscript:
-
type: text
marks:
-
type: superscript
text: '2'Small text:
-
type: text
marks:
-
type: small
text: 'Fine print'Links
Links are a mark with attrs containing the href:
-
type: text
marks:
-
type: link
attrs:
href: 'https://example.com'
text: 'Click here'Link with target and rel attributes:
-
type: text
marks:
-
type: link
attrs:
href: 'https://example.com'
target: _blank
rel: 'noopener noreferrer'
text: 'External link'Links to Statamic entries use the entry:: prefix:
-
type: text
marks:
-
type: link
attrs:
href: 'entry::some-entry-id'
text: 'Internal link'Mixed Inline Content
A paragraph often contains a mix of plain and formatted text. Each run of text with different formatting is a separate node in the content array:
-
type: paragraph
content:
-
type: text
text: 'This is '
-
type: text
marks:
-
type: bold
text: 'important'
-
type: text
text: ' information.'Lists

story: []Globals
Global sets store site-wide data. Configs live at content/globals/{handle}.yaml, values at content/globals/default/{handle}.yaml, and blueprints at resources/blueprints/globals/{handle}.yaml.
Accessing Globals in Templates
{{ settings:website_name }}
{{ settings:primary_contact_tel }}
{{ settings:socials }}
{{ name }} — {{ link }}
{{ /settings:socials }}Taxonomies
Taxonomies live in content/taxonomies/. Each taxonomy has a config YAML and term files in a subfolder.
Taxonomy Terms
Terms are YAML files in content/taxonomies/{handle}/:
# content/taxonomies/categories/my-term.yaml
title: My TermAttaching Taxonomies to Collections
In the collection config:
taxonomies:
- categoriesIn the blueprint, add a terms field:
-
handle: category
field:
type: terms
taxonomies:
- categories
display: Category
mode: select
max_items: 1In content files, reference terms by slug:
category:
- my_termNavigation

Replicators allow content editors to build flexible content by stacking predefined sets of fields. They appear in blueprints, fieldsets, and globals.
Replicator Content Format
items:
-
id: item-1
type: my_set
value: 'Some value'
label: 'Some label'
enabled: true
-
id: item-2
type: my_set
value: 'Another value'
label: 'Another label'
enabled: trueEach item needs id, type (matching the set handle), and enabled. The remaining fields come from the set's field definitions.

Statamic addons are Laravel packages that extend Statamic's functionality. They live in addons/{vendor}/{name}/ during local development and are registered as path repositories in the root composer.json.
Addon Directory Structure
A Statamic addon follows this layout:
addons/{vendor}/{name}/
├── composer.json # Package definition + Statamic/Laravel metadata
├── package.json # Node dependencies (if addon has CP JS)
├── vite.config.js # Vite config for building CP assets
├── phpunit.xml # Test configuration
├── config/
│ └── {name}.php # Publishable config file
├── resources/
│ ├── js/
│ │ ├── cp.js # CP JavaScript entry point
│ │ └── components/ # Vue components for the CP
│ ├── views/ # Blade views (for CP pages)
│ └── dist/ # Built assets (committed for distribution)
├── routes/
│ ├── api.php # Public/API routes
│ └── cp.php # Control Panel routes
├── src/
│ ├── ServiceProvider.php # Main addon service provider
│ ├── Http/
│ │ ├── Controllers/ # Route controllers
│ │ └── Middleware/ # Custom middleware
│ ├── Support/ # Helper/utility classes
│ ├── Policies/ # Authorization policies
│ ├── Exceptions/ # Custom exception classes
│ └── Tools/ # Domain-specific classes
│ └── Contracts/ # Interfaces
└── tests/
├── TestCase.php # Base test case
├── Unit/ # Unit tests
├── Integration/ # Integration tests
└── Property/ # Property-based tests (optional)Addon composer.json
The addon's composer.json defines the package, its autoloading, and Statamic/Laravel metadata:
{
"name": "{vendor}/{name}",
"autoload": {
"psr-4": {
"{Vendor}\\{Name}\\": "src"
}
},
"autoload-dev": {
"psr-4": {
"{Vendor}\\{Name}\\Tests\\": "tests"
}
},
"require": {
"statamic/cms": "^6.0"
},
"require-dev": {
"orchestra/testbench": "^10.8"
},
"config": {
"allow-plugins": {
"pixelfear/composer-dist-plugin": true
}
},
"extra": {
"statamic": {
"name": "My Addon",
"description": "What the addon does"
},
"laravel": {
"providers": [
"{Vendor}\\{Name}\\ServiceProvider"
]
}
},
"minimum-stability": "dev",
"prefer-stable": true
}Key points:
extra.statamicprovides the addon name and description for the Statamic marketplace/CP.extra.laravel.providersregisters the service provider for auto-discovery.pixelfear/composer-dist-pluginmust be allowed for Statamic's asset distribution.
Registering the Addon in the Root Project
In the root composer.json, add a path repository and require the addon:
{
"repositories": [
{
"type": "path",
"url": "addons/{vendor}/{name}"
}
],
"require": {
"{vendor}/{name}": "*@dev"
}
}Then run composer update to symlink the addon into vendor/.
The Service Provider
Every addon has a service provider that extends Statamic\Providers\AddonServiceProvider. This is the central registration point for everything the addon provides.
<?php
namespace {Vendor}\{Name};
use Statamic\Facades\CP\Nav;
use Statamic\Providers\AddonServiceProvider;
class ServiceProvider extends AddonServiceProvider
{
// Namespace for Blade views: used as '{namespace}::view.name'
protected $viewNamespace = '{name}';
// Vite configuration for CP JavaScript/CSS assets
protected $vite = [
'input' => [
'resources/js/cp.js',
],
'publicDirectory' => 'resources/dist',
'hotFile' => __DIR__.'/../resources/dist/hot',
];
public function register(): void
{
parent::register();
// Merge default config so config('{name}.key') works immediately
$this->mergeConfigFrom(__DIR__.'/../config/{name}.php', '{name}');
// Register singletons that need to be available early
$this->app->singleton(SomeRepository::class);
}
public function bootAddon(): void
{
// Publish config file: php artisan vendor:publish --tag={name}-config
$this->publishes([
__DIR__.'/../config/{name}.php' => config_path('{name}.php'),
], '{name}-config');
// Register CP navigation items
$this->bootCp();
// Conditionally load routes, bindings, etc.
if (! config('{name}.enabled')) {
return; // Addon is invisible when disabled
}
$this->loadRoutesFrom(__DIR__.'/../routes/api.php');
// Register additional singletons
$this->app->singleton(SomeService::class, function ($app) {
return new SomeService($app);
});
}
protected function bootCp(): void
{
Nav::extend(function ($nav) {
$nav->tools('My Addon')
->route('{name}.settings.index')
->icon('some-icon');
});
}
}Key patterns:
register()runs first — merge config and bind early singletons here.bootAddon()is the Statamic-specific boot method (notboot()). Load routes, publish assets, and register CP nav here.- The
$viteproperty tells Statamic where to find the addon's built JS/CSS assets. - The
$viewNamespaceproperty sets the Blade view namespace. - Use a kill switch pattern (
config('{name}.enabled')) to make the addon completely invisible when disabled — no routes, no bindings. - CP nav items should always be registered (even when the addon is disabled) so admins can access settings to enable it.
AddonServiceProvider Built-in Properties
AddonServiceProvider provides several properties you can set to register things declaratively:
// Register route files
protected $routes = [
'cp' => __DIR__.'/../routes/cp.php',
'web' => __DIR__.'/../routes/web.php',
'actions' => __DIR__.'/../routes/actions.php',
];
// Register event listeners
protected $listen = [
SomeEvent::class => [SomeListener::class],
];
// Register custom fieldtypes
protected $fieldtypes = [MyFieldtype::class];
// Register custom tags
protected $tags = [MyTag::class];
// Register custom modifiers
protected $modifiers = [MyModifier::class];
// Register custom widgets (CP dashboard)
protected $widgets = [MyWidget::class];
// Register custom actions (bulk actions in listings)
protected $actions = [MyAction::class];
// Register custom scopes (query scopes for listings)
protected $scopes = [MyScope::class];
// Register custom policies
protected $policies = [
SomeModel::class => SomePolicy::class,
];
// Register publishable assets
protected $publishables = [
__DIR__.'/../public' => 'vendor/{name}',
];
// Register scheduled commands
protected $commands = [MyCommand::class];
// Register middleware
protected $middlewareGroups = [
'statamic.cp.authenticated' => [MyMiddleware::class],
];
// Register update scripts
protected $updateScripts = [UpdateSomething::class];Config Files

Routes
Addon routes are standard Laravel route files. API routes and CP routes are typically separate.
API routes (routes/api.php):
<?php
use Illuminate\Support\Facades\Route;
use {Vendor}\{Name}\Http\Controllers\MyController;
use {Vendor}\{Name}\Http\Middleware\MyMiddleware;
Route::prefix('{name}')
->middleware([MyMiddleware::class])
->group(function () {
Route::post('/action', [MyController::class, 'action']);
Route::get('/status', [MyController::class, 'status']);
});CP routes (routes/cp.php):
<?php
use Illuminate\Support\Facades\Route;
use {Vendor}\{Name}\Http\Controllers\SettingsController;
Route::prefix('{name}')->group(function () {
Route::get('/settings', [SettingsController::class, 'index'])->name('{name}.settings.index');
Route::post('/settings', [SettingsController::class, 'update'])->name('{name}.settings.update');
});CP routes are automatically wrapped in Statamic's CP middleware (authentication, etc.). Load API routes manually in bootAddon() with $this->loadRoutesFrom(). CP routes can be declared via the $routes property or loaded manually.
CP Views and Vue Components
Addon CP pages use Blade views that extend Statamic's layout and mount Vue components.
Blade view (resources/views/settings/index.blade.php):
@extends('statamic::layout')
@section('title', 'My Addon Settings')
@section('content')
<my-settings-component
:settings='@json($settings)'
update-url="{{ cp_route('{name}.settings.update') }}"
csrf-token="{{ csrf_token() }}"
></my-settings-component>
@endsectionJS entry point (resources/js/cp.js):
import MySettings from './components/MySettings.vue';
Statamic.booting(() => {
Statamic.$components.register('my-settings-component', MySettings);
});Vue components are registered via Statamic.$components.register() during the Statamic.booting() lifecycle hook. The component name in JS must match the tag name used in the Blade view.

}Vite Configuration for Addons
Addons use Vite with the @statamic/cms vite plugin and laravel-vite-plugin:
// vite.config.js
import { defineConfig } from 'vite';
import laravel from 'laravel-vite-plugin';
import statamic from '@statamic/cms/vite-plugin';
export default defineConfig({
plugins: [
statamic(),
laravel({
input: ['resources/js/cp.js'],
refresh: true,
publicDirectory: 'resources/dist',
hotFile: 'resources/dist/hot',
}),
],
});package.json:
{
"private": true,
"scripts": {
"dev": "rm -rf resources/dist/build && vite",
"build": "vite build"
},
"devDependencies": {
"@statamic/cms": "file:./vendor/statamic/cms/resources/dist-package",
"laravel-vite-plugin": "^1.3.0",
"vite": "^6.4.1"
}
}The @statamic/cms dependency points to the local Statamic dist package within the addon's vendor directory. Run pnpm install (or npm install) from within the addon directory, then pnpm run build to compile assets into resources/dist/build/.

Updating an Existing Addon
When modifying an addon:
- PHP changes in
src/take effect immediately (the addon is symlinked via Composer path repository). - Config changes require
php artisan config:clearor republishing. - Vue/JS changes require rebuilding: run
pnpm run buildfrom the addon directory. - New routes or service provider changes may require
php artisan cache:clear. - New test files are picked up automatically by PHPUnit.
- If you add new Composer dependencies to the addon, run
composer updatefrom both the addon directory and the root project.
